What is the two step model
phobias are acquired by classical conditioning and maintained by operant conditioning
What is a strength to the two stop model
has real world application
exposure therapies such as systematic desensitisation prevents avoidance
What’s a limitation of the two step model
its reductionist as it avoids cognitive factors such as irrational beleifs so it doesnt explain all symptoms
